TECHNOLOGY:

 

Laminated Woodcore: This tip-to-tail laminated woodcore is specially shaped for each model and size. Using different wood types in various combinations allows adjustment of flex pattern for different uses. This extremely responsive and highly durable woodcore transmits power directly to the edges and allows versatility in various piste conditions.

SST: Sidewall Construction features a vertically placed ABS material above the edges from tip to tail of the ski. Sidewall offers direct power transmission from the skier's foot to the edge for control and stability at speeds and provides acceleration out of the turns.

Fibreglass Reinforcements: positioned above and below the core, the fibre glass reinforcements help optimise the flex and improve torque stiffness.
